2,147,541,048 is a composite number, even.
2,147,541,048 (two billion one hundred forty-seven million five hundred forty-one thousand forty-eight) is an even 10-digit number. It is a composite number with 48 divisors, and factors as 2³ × 3² × 17 × 1,754,527. Its proper divisors sum to 4,010,852,232,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x8000E038.

Interpreted as seconds since the Unix epoch (Jan 1 1970 UTC), this is 2038-01-19 19:10:48 UTC (weekday:Tuesday).
Many software systems represent time this way; very common in logs and APIs.
